Our Company – PLAYSTUDIOS VIETNAM

Come join an ambitious mobile entertainment company which committed to leveraging the best technology we can to create fun experiences. PLAYSTUDIOS Vietnam is a subsidiary of the United States based leading mobile & social games company PLAYSTUDIOS Inc.

We are backed by dominant, multi-billion-dollar market leaders in the leisure and video game industries and a collection of powerhouse venture capital firms. Our founding team has over a century of collective gaming experience.

We at PLAYSTUDIOS have the pleasure of working on multiple games, from “POP! Slots”, a real-time MMO (massively multiplayer online) game, played by millions of users across the world, with new features released on a daily basis, to our latest addition of the Tetris brand.

The Java Backend team in PLAYSTUDIOS is responsible for building high-scale cloud-based real-time systems while facing unique challenges in the multiplayer world.

We love clean architecture and implementations that plan ahead and see the big picture (product-wise and technology-wise), we encourage learning (and failing) and sharing, and we deeply believe in taking responsibility and ownership of our projects.

We’re looking for a team player with strong communication skills, who’s not afraid of asking others and of self-learning. While having constant guidance, we expect you to quickly grasp complex systems and take full ownership of your domain.

We're thrilled to share:


RESPONSIBILITIES

  • Develop the backend services of our core game and features - from infrastructure to game logic, in Java and in Lua.
  • Execute full software development lifecycle: architect, design, implement, test (Unit, Integration & Manual testing), deploy and monitor.
  • Develop microservice-based distributed systems, both from scratch and by decomposing legacy components.
  • Investigate and solve production issues.
  • Ensure stability, security, performance and architectural cleanliness of our system.
  • Push and develop efficiency initiatives for our dev teams and the whole pipeline.

QUALIFICATIONS

  • B.Sc in Computer Science or other equivalent experience
  • 3+ years (for Middle level) and 5+ years (for Senior level) of Java skills and object-oriented design experiences
  • Good command of English - written and spoken

Advantages:

    • Experience with distributed systems and microservices architecture
    • Experience with scripting languages (Python/Lua/JS/Go etc.)
    • Experience with Spring framework (Spring, Spring Boot etc.)
    • Experience with Message brokers or Stream-processing solutions (RabbitMQ/Kafka etc.)
    • Experience with dependency management frameworks (Maven/Gradle/Ant etc.)
    • Experience developing real-time large-scale applications
    • Experience in developing (or playing) online games
    • Experience with Cloud Platforms (AWS/GCP/Azure), Serverless applications and container technologies (Docker, Kubernetes etc.)
    • Experience with Splunk or other log analysis tool
    • Experience with Agile/SCRUM

    BENEFITS AND PERKS

    • Work directly with a global team of young and talented playMAKERS regardless of gender, age or experience.
    • Unlimited growth opportunities and continuous improvement with English classes, workshops and other technical training courses by highly-skilled members from all over the world
    • Bao Viet Premium healthcare coverage is 1.2 billion VND/person/year (including you and ALL your dependents).
    • A company of fulfillment: 100% salary on probation, 100% covered Social insurance, Health insurance and Unemployment insurance since probation. Moreover, Compulsory insurance for employees is also filled by the company. You only need to bear PIT.
    • 13 months salary/year.
    • Discretionary bonus.
    • Employee referral bonus program (Very attractive bonus range: from 300USD to 1000USD).
    • Flexible working time: 5 working days/ week - from Monday to Friday (Time won't be your fear, because productivity is what we care about).
    • Annual leave: 15 days in 1st year, 17 days in 2nd year, and 20 days each year thereafter
    • Sick leave: 5 days/year
    • Delicious, fresh and free meals are served daily!
    • High-end workstation laptop and screens (For Artist: optional Wacom Intuos Pro or Cintiq).
    • Equipment Allowance: 4,500,000 VND to pick your keyboard/ mouse/ headphone... in your own style.
    • Team building activities, staff trips, and company events across the year.
    • Other benefits: Sickness, funeral: support up to 2,000,000 VND/person; marriage, childbirth, and public holidays: up to 500,000 VND/person.